Here's my full review, this was definitely the most memorable Tool show I've ever seen.

First was mastodon, and to be honest I liked them more in Leuven. Funny how they went through exact the same motions during their set. I think they're an above average band. But not just there yet...and maybe a new sound man would help...

Then came Tool, opening with Stinkfist. I believe Maynard couldn't sing the first line because he was blinded by a flash light of a press photograper. Maynard came to the front of the stage and yanked the photographer(immediately escorted out by tour manager). Damn scary to see a dude wearing a huge mask storming right at you I guess. The rest of the song was spot on, as usual.
During The Pot, 46 and 2 and Jambi it became evident that the guys seemed even more interested then in Leuven. Maynard was actually interacting with the crowd, doing some waving and stuff and said "Hi, good to see you a-gain". Schism came with the fast middle section that I love more every time I hear it. Justin again rocked like he always does.
Up next was Lost Keys and Rosetta Stoned, maynards dancing during Rosetta Stoned was awesome(btw he didn't use hiss megaphone untill the last part of the song). He was laying flat on his back while glancing at the crowd and his legs lifted up in a 90° angle. To put it simple it was HILARIOUS. He "danced" like that for some 6 minutes of the song and then reached out to his megaphone put it to the ground and sang while allmost ritually shuffling around it. Wow that's 6 lines of typing but still not a great description. You had to see it. Adam allmost had a little laugh on his face if I saw well.(He was in top form all the way baby)
I guess next was Danny's drum solo, Danny reminded me of the squid drummer in the Spongebob band, funny to think about 'Bob when watching Tool.
Following the solo everyone exepted the Sober riff, but we got a tasty little treat in Swamp Song(I thought it was a little extended even, not really sure). When it started I thought it was going to be Opiate but Swamp Song not in my wildest dreams...For everyone out there they can still play it like it was 1996 ( not that I know though, I was 10 at that time).
The rest of the night was one hell of victory parade, except the Laser incident, Laser mist Adam and Maynard's eyes by well not much I dare say. That would've been end of show...(break your fucking neck)
Maynard made some notions of how Tool would sample "our" chocolate and said they would come around next summer and thanked the crowd that from my standpoint was way more into it then the one in Leuven (Venue off course being a huge factor).
Lateralus, Vicarious and Aenema were all highlights for the night.
